Belgian based urban artist creating in a variety of mediums and supports including spray paint, acrylics, ballpoint, paint markers, collages, hand-cut paper and stencils.
Studied art history and advertising art at the academy of Leuven (SLAC).
Versatile and experimental approach to stencil, inspired by traditional Japanese papercuts (kiri-e), anti-pop culture in the eighties and the arts & crafts movement of the 19th century.
Stencil and papercut design is based on small intricate ink drawings, often the stencil is used just once (as opposed to serigraphy), afterwards the pochoir is colored with acrylics and ttransforms into a decorative artwork itself. This cycle forces the artist to continuously come up with new designs and run through the cycle again.
The process from drawing to finished work is completely analogue, without the use of software or photo filters. Some designs involve more geometrics, resulting in analog halftone designs with a 'trompe l'oeil' effect.
Latest works are built up with up to forty layers of spray paint, resulting in softened lines and exploring the limits of the stencil medium towards photorealism.
Work was presented in group shows with artists like C215, Jef Aerosol, Blek Le Rat, Vhils, Banksy, Miss Tic and Shepard Fairey.
